Thrown-ness
A concept from existential philosophy describing the arbitrary circumstances into which a person is born, emphasizing the lack of control one has over their initial placement in life.
Rogerian Psychotherapy
A client-centered approach to therapy developed by Carl Rogers, focusing on the individual's capacity for self-direction and understanding in a supportive environment.
Humanistic View
A psychological perspective emphasizing individual potential for growth and the importance of human values, creativity, and self-actualization.
Mental Health
A state of well-being in which an individual realizes their own abilities, can cope with the normal stresses of life, work productively, and is able to make contributions to their community.
